Siebrand Mazeland [Thu, 22 Oct 2009 21:43:30 +0000 (21:43 +0000)]
Revert r58033. This change made all command line scripts of the Translate extension (scripts/ subfolder) exit without any information or without doing anything.
Raimond Spekking [Thu, 22 Oct 2009 20:00:27 +0000 (20:00 +0000)]
Fix for r58035: PLURAL needs wfMsgExt with 'parsemag' option
'activeusers-summary' is still a valid message.
Katie Filbert [Thu, 22 Oct 2009 19:38:39 +0000 (19:38 +0000)]
* (bug 19319) Add activeusers-intro message at top of SpecialActiveUsers page
Raimond Spekking [Thu, 22 Oct 2009 18:59:44 +0000 (18:59 +0000)]
Localisation updates for core and extension messages from translatewiki.net (2009-10-21 18:00 UTC)
Max Semenik [Thu, 22 Oct 2009 18:47:27 +0000 (18:47 +0000)]
Set a nonzero exit status in case of maintenance script failure
Max Semenik [Thu, 22 Oct 2009 18:04:08 +0000 (18:04 +0000)]
Finished bringing SQLite updater in par with MySQL
Max Semenik [Thu, 22 Oct 2009 17:48:09 +0000 (17:48 +0000)]
SQLite updater: don't keep the old tables hanging around renamed after creating indexes, we explicitly tell people to backup before upgrading:D
Rotem Liss [Thu, 22 Oct 2009 17:19:05 +0000 (17:19 +0000)]
Localization fix.
Jure Kajzer [Thu, 22 Oct 2009 17:02:15 +0000 (17:02 +0000)]
changed def. gender to unknown.
Max Semenik [Thu, 22 Oct 2009 16:58:13 +0000 (16:58 +0000)]
Separate patch-rd_interwiki.sql for SQLite
Katie Filbert [Thu, 22 Oct 2009 16:54:50 +0000 (16:54 +0000)]
more specific error message, using WikiError, if user trys to create account with hash character
Jure Kajzer [Thu, 22 Oct 2009 16:48:43 +0000 (16:48 +0000)]
Added default value for gender and editfont to avoid Global default invalid message.
Rotem Liss [Thu, 22 Oct 2009 16:48:12 +0000 (16:48 +0000)]
Localization update.
Raimond Spekking [Thu, 22 Oct 2009 16:39:20 +0000 (16:39 +0000)]
* (bug 21047) Wrap 'cannotdelete' into a div with the generic 'error' class and an own 'mw-error-cannotdelete' class
Based on a patch by Platonides
Rotem Liss [Thu, 22 Oct 2009 16:33:44 +0000 (16:33 +0000)]
Localization update for he.
Katie Filbert [Thu, 22 Oct 2009 16:06:59 +0000 (16:06 +0000)]
simplify prefs-help-email, add usernamehasherror for more specific account creation errors
Alexandre Emsenhuber [Thu, 22 Oct 2009 15:51:01 +0000 (15:51 +0000)]
* (bug 21006) maintenance/updateArticleCount.php now works again on PostgreSQL
Max Semenik [Thu, 22 Oct 2009 15:39:07 +0000 (15:39 +0000)]
That way of percentage calculation was an epic fail:)
Alexandre Emsenhuber [Thu, 22 Oct 2009 15:11:52 +0000 (15:11 +0000)]
* (bug 21053) Fixed diff header layout for multi diffs with no changes
Alexandre Emsenhuber [Thu, 22 Oct 2009 14:50:45 +0000 (14:50 +0000)]
* (bug 21234) Moving subpages of titles containing \\ now works properly
Per http://www.php.net/manual/en/function.preg-replace.php \ must be doubled in $replacement
Andrew Garrett [Thu, 22 Oct 2009 13:54:36 +0000 (13:54 +0000)]
Add some hook HTML injection points to EditForm, between the Copyright warning and the content, and after the preview content.
Katie Filbert [Thu, 22 Oct 2009 13:47:44 +0000 (13:47 +0000)]
bump up style version, followup for r57992
Chad Horohoe [Thu, 22 Oct 2009 12:12:12 +0000 (12:12 +0000)]
Add profiling to getEffectiveGroups()
Chad Horohoe [Thu, 22 Oct 2009 11:40:38 +0000 (11:40 +0000)]
(bug 21222) Free <math> tag if not using it. Patch by Platonides.
OverlordQ [Thu, 22 Oct 2009 08:22:32 +0000 (08:22 +0000)]
Followup to r57868: some maint scripts still call recordUpload which did not get updated when getInitialPageText was moved to a different class
Niklas Laxström [Thu, 22 Oct 2009 06:18:41 +0000 (06:18 +0000)]
Fix syntax errors from r57989
Raimond Spekking [Thu, 22 Oct 2009 06:01:23 +0000 (06:01 +0000)]
Follow-up r57991: Message not longer to ignore for translatewiki
Katie Filbert [Thu, 22 Oct 2009 02:38:11 +0000 (02:38 +0000)]
add border, styles for login and account forms for Vector skin
Bryan Tong Minh [Wed, 21 Oct 2009 21:29:05 +0000 (21:29 +0000)]
* Bump wgStyleVersion for various upload javascript edits in this revision and r57868.
* Show the upload footer message outside of the form
* Document some remaining SpecialUpload functions
* Move upload edittools to just below the textarea
* Add the license preview table row in javascript entirely
* Fill in a forgotten message
Alexandre Emsenhuber [Wed, 21 Oct 2009 21:22:00 +0000 (21:22 +0000)]
Fix for r57986: Notice: Undefined variable: wgEnableOpenSearchSuggest in includes/api/ApiOpenSearch.php on line 53
Max Semenik [Wed, 21 Oct 2009 19:53:03 +0000 (19:53 +0000)]
(bug 20275) Fixed LIKE queries on SQLite backend
* All manually built LIKE queries in the core are replaced with a wrapper function Database::buildLike()
* This function automatically performs all escaping, so Database::escapeLike() is now almost never used
Raimond Spekking [Wed, 21 Oct 2009 18:55:26 +0000 (18:55 +0000)]
Localisation updates for core and extension messages from translatewiki.net (2009-10-21 18:10 UTC)
Roan Kattouw [Wed, 21 Oct 2009 18:44:58 +0000 (18:44 +0000)]
Split allowing &suggest requests in API opensearch from $wgEnableMWSuggest to a separate variable. This makes it possible to enable SimpleSearch (which uses API opensearch) but disable mwsuggest; enabling both seems to cause issues with the login form in Safari or Opera (don't remember which)
Roan Kattouw [Wed, 21 Oct 2009 17:35:57 +0000 (17:35 +0000)]
* Export the return value of wfUrlProtocols() to JS for use in the EditToolbar extension
* Also cache this value (in a static var for now, maybe put it in memcached?): when parsing pages with many external links, we'd end up calling implode() once and preg_quote() 11 times for every link
Alexandre Emsenhuber [Wed, 21 Oct 2009 15:13:57 +0000 (15:13 +0000)]
Fix typo from r57971, thanks Nikerabbit
Max Semenik [Wed, 21 Oct 2009 12:21:09 +0000 (12:21 +0000)]
(bug 20268) Fixed Database::estimateRowCount on SQLite backend. This involved moving the previous implementation to where it belongs - DatabaseMysql, and replacing it with slightly tweaked DB2 implementation.
Alexandre Emsenhuber [Wed, 21 Oct 2009 11:42:10 +0000 (11:42 +0000)]
* (bug 21161) Changing $wgCaCacheEpoch now always invalidates file cache
Based on a patch by Platonides - http://bug-attachment.wikimedia.org/attachment.cgi?id=6678
Alexandre Emsenhuber [Wed, 21 Oct 2009 08:45:15 +0000 (08:45 +0000)]
removed "make maint" since t/maint was removed in r54908.
Siebrand Mazeland [Wed, 21 Oct 2009 08:15:39 +0000 (08:15 +0000)]
(bug 20847) Remove akeytt() function, but leave dummy. Contributed by Derk-Jan Hartman
OverlordQ [Wed, 21 Oct 2009 05:36:24 +0000 (05:36 +0000)]
Fix Special:ActiveUsers for PG, double-quotes are used to delimit identifiers not strings
OverlordQ [Wed, 21 Oct 2009 05:25:15 +0000 (05:25 +0000)]
One more to r57964, forgot to apply update to updaters.inc
OverlordQ [Wed, 21 Oct 2009 02:50:45 +0000 (02:50 +0000)]
Followup to r57964, forgot to revert column change
OverlordQ [Wed, 21 Oct 2009 02:46:39 +0000 (02:46 +0000)]
Add missing columns to PG schemas
Add exceptions to schema comparison script
Alter SQL comments to appease said script
Michael Dale [Wed, 21 Oct 2009 00:23:39 +0000 (00:23 +0000)]
* html5 file api drag drop file stubs
Max Semenik [Tue, 20 Oct 2009 21:46:18 +0000 (21:46 +0000)]
In hopes that at least one of my commits will stick, moving myself from patch contributors to devs :D
Max Semenik [Tue, 20 Oct 2009 21:03:08 +0000 (21:03 +0000)]
Follow up to r57949: rm message that makes no sense now
Max Semenik [Tue, 20 Oct 2009 20:23:14 +0000 (20:23 +0000)]
(bug 20911) Installer failed to create a SQLite database, regression from r55669.
Roan Kattouw [Tue, 20 Oct 2009 19:48:22 +0000 (19:48 +0000)]
Whitespace cleanup for r57877
Roan Kattouw [Tue, 20 Oct 2009 19:47:20 +0000 (19:47 +0000)]
Fix fatal in r57877: can't use $this in a static function
Max Semenik [Tue, 20 Oct 2009 19:11:23 +0000 (19:11 +0000)]
Follow-up to r57949: whitespace tweaks
Raimond Spekking [Tue, 20 Oct 2009 18:59:27 +0000 (18:59 +0000)]
Localisation updates for core and extension messages from translatewiki.net (2009-10-20 18:10 UTC)
Adam Miller [Tue, 20 Oct 2009 18:58:59 +0000 (18:58 +0000)]
Updates to experimental color scheme a
Max Semenik [Tue, 20 Oct 2009 18:21:08 +0000 (18:21 +0000)]
(bug 20242) Installer no longer promts for user credentials for SQLite databases
Michael Dale [Tue, 20 Oct 2009 00:25:36 +0000 (00:25 +0000)]
* set the --wiki to wfWikiId
Michael Dale [Mon, 19 Oct 2009 23:56:29 +0000 (23:56 +0000)]
* close up the </ul> bug 21188
* white space removal
Michael Dale [Mon, 19 Oct 2009 23:50:42 +0000 (23:50 +0000)]
* fixed js2 fileexist checking related to rewrite of special upload page in r57868
Michael Dale [Mon, 19 Oct 2009 23:31:31 +0000 (23:31 +0000)]
* fixed bug 21193 updated on new source selection
Roan Kattouw [Mon, 19 Oct 2009 20:53:20 +0000 (20:53 +0000)]
Bump style version for r57916
Adam Miller [Mon, 19 Oct 2009 20:50:35 +0000 (20:50 +0000)]
setting white-space to nowrap on the nav tabs in vector for better animating
Bryan Tong Minh [Mon, 19 Oct 2009 19:55:54 +0000 (19:55 +0000)]
Parse the edittools message so that it actually works (follow up to r57868).
Message is now also customizable.
Raimond Spekking [Mon, 19 Oct 2009 19:34:51 +0000 (19:34 +0000)]
Localisation updates for core and extension messages from translatewiki.net (2009-10-19 18:50 UTC)
Tim Starling [Mon, 19 Oct 2009 19:11:56 +0000 (19:11 +0000)]
Reintroduced $wgRateLimitsExcludedIPs from r47352 (removed in r51045). $wgAutopromote does not work for anonymous users.
Michael Dale [Mon, 19 Oct 2009 18:48:29 +0000 (18:48 +0000)]
* removed extra comma that breaks IE r57858#c4283
Alexandre Emsenhuber [Mon, 19 Oct 2009 18:24:32 +0000 (18:24 +0000)]
* (bug 21183) Missing global declaration of $wgLang in SpecialUpload::processVerificationError()
Patch by Platonides - http://bug-attachment.wikimedia.org/attachment.cgi?id=6686
Michael Dale [Mon, 19 Oct 2009 18:10:36 +0000 (18:10 +0000)]
* fixed some minor apiproxy bugs
Adam Miller [Mon, 19 Oct 2009 17:24:00 +0000 (17:24 +0000)]
further color scheme a tweaks from hannes
Raimond Spekking [Mon, 19 Oct 2009 17:14:51 +0000 (17:14 +0000)]
Self revert r57897. New patch follows.
Raimond Spekking [Mon, 19 Oct 2009 16:43:31 +0000 (16:43 +0000)]
* (bug 21047) Wrap "cannotdelete" message into a div with the generic 'error' class and a specific 'mw-error-cannotdelete' class
Based on a patch by Platonides
Raimond Spekking [Mon, 19 Oct 2009 14:26:16 +0000 (14:26 +0000)]
* bug 21182 Fix invalid HTML in Special:Listgrouprights
Patch by Platonides
Raimond Spekking [Mon, 19 Oct 2009 12:38:22 +0000 (12:38 +0000)]
* (bug 21168) Added linktrail to Portuguese (pt)
Jack Phoenix [Mon, 19 Oct 2009 11:15:51 +0000 (11:15 +0000)]
coding style tweaks
Michael Dale [Mon, 19 Oct 2009 05:35:31 +0000 (05:35 +0000)]
* proxy iFrame upload working for copy-by-url to shared repository
* add paging system for flickerSearch
* some mw.proxy refactoring to handle present user dialogs when proxy connection can't be established.
Fenzik Joseph [Mon, 19 Oct 2009 03:01:11 +0000 (03:01 +0000)]
* function isValidPassword modified to return boolean(true/false)
* Added function getPasswordValidity return error message on failure for the given unvalidated password input.
* Replaced isValidPassword() fn call to getPasswordValidity() in SpecialUserlogin.php
Michael Dale [Sun, 18 Oct 2009 21:03:24 +0000 (21:03 +0000)]
* some updates to the api_proxy examples and code
* display:none on iframe for ~background~ requests
* append to page example added to testApiProxy.html
* We could make some optimization by thinning out the MediaWiki:ApiProxy page by replacing it with a simple page without styles & extra js
* added a iframe status callback for quicker timeouts
Rotem Liss [Sun, 18 Oct 2009 20:24:39 +0000 (20:24 +0000)]
Localization update.
Bryan Tong Minh [Sun, 18 Oct 2009 20:06:22 +0000 (20:06 +0000)]
Followup to r57868: Fix two strict standards warnings
Raimond Spekking [Sun, 18 Oct 2009 19:54:06 +0000 (19:54 +0000)]
Follow-up r57868: Update language maintenance scripts
Bryan Tong Minh [Sun, 18 Oct 2009 19:41:01 +0000 (19:41 +0000)]
Rewrote Special:Upload to allow easier extension. Mostly backwards compatible towards the end user: tested with Commons' upload scripts.
* Special:Upload now uses HTMLForm for form generation
* Upload errors that can be solved by changing the filename now do not require reuploading.
Bryan Tong Minh [Sun, 18 Oct 2009 19:29:35 +0000 (19:29 +0000)]
Update HTMLForm for upcoming Special:Upload rewrite.
* Add support for edittools
* Add support for multipart/form-data
* Set id for wpEditToken
* Add support for tooltip and accesskey
* Allow setting a name for the submit button
* Give sections an id
Raimond Spekking [Sun, 18 Oct 2009 19:15:28 +0000 (19:15 +0000)]
Localisation updates for core and extension messages from translatewiki.net (2009-10-18 18:00 UTC)
Max Semenik [Sun, 18 Oct 2009 10:55:36 +0000 (10:55 +0000)]
Added a script for SQLite-specific maintenance tasks
Michael Dale [Sat, 17 Oct 2009 20:22:34 +0000 (20:22 +0000)]
* fixes old toolbar usage where $j.wikiEditor is defined
Max Semenik [Sat, 17 Oct 2009 17:21:00 +0000 (17:21 +0000)]
(bug 20880) Fixed updater failure on SQLite backend
Max Semenik [Sat, 17 Oct 2009 12:23:23 +0000 (12:23 +0000)]
(bug 20256) Fixed SQL errors on Special:Recentchanges and Special:Recentchangeslinked on SQLite backend
Michael Dale [Sat, 17 Oct 2009 10:35:46 +0000 (10:35 +0000)]
* stubs for api iFrame Proxy system. Early summary in /js2/mwEmbed/apiProxy/
** testing page for proxy setup (hard coded to localhost)
** added basic support to skin.php for enabling of apiproxy (off by default)
* added flickrSearch as another remote repository
* other refactoring, cleanup of remoteSearchDriver (add-media-wizard)
* removed query.json.1-3.js
* removed jquery.secureEvalJSON.js
* replaced with official http://www.JSON.org/json2.js script which is only included if JSON is undefined
Alexandre Emsenhuber [Sat, 17 Oct 2009 08:29:15 +0000 (08:29 +0000)]
* (bug 21079) There is no more line wrapping between label and field in Special:Log
Aaron Schulz [Sat, 17 Oct 2009 05:10:21 +0000 (05:10 +0000)]
Removed unexplained newline at top of file. No idea why that got there.
Aaron Schulz [Sat, 17 Oct 2009 05:06:41 +0000 (05:06 +0000)]
Follow up r57846: tack on an error code
Aaron Schulz [Sat, 17 Oct 2009 04:18:49 +0000 (04:18 +0000)]
* Fixed fatal for bad wlowner usernames
* Use the relevant user object to check patrol abilities rather than always using $wgUser
Michael Dale [Sat, 17 Oct 2009 00:41:05 +0000 (00:41 +0000)]
* updated repository icons transparency
Siebrand Mazeland [Fri, 16 Oct 2009 18:09:09 +0000 (18:09 +0000)]
Fix bad diff checking in r57822
Siebrand Mazeland [Fri, 16 Oct 2009 17:57:27 +0000 (17:57 +0000)]
Remove use of badly supported <blink> tag.
Michael Dale [Fri, 16 Oct 2009 17:32:40 +0000 (17:32 +0000)]
* (bug 21152) fixed position of playhead to seek position on native html5 seeking
Alexandre Emsenhuber [Fri, 16 Oct 2009 12:30:56 +0000 (12:30 +0000)]
compress option needs a value :)
Alexandre Emsenhuber [Fri, 16 Oct 2009 08:58:59 +0000 (08:58 +0000)]
Readd line break which was lost in r54225
Alexandre Emsenhuber [Fri, 16 Oct 2009 08:21:02 +0000 (08:21 +0000)]
Follow-up r57356: forgot to document $exclude param
Raimond Spekking [Fri, 16 Oct 2009 06:59:59 +0000 (06:59 +0000)]
Split time and date for better i18n
Translatewiki uses this since months but it was was never done in core?!
Michael Dale [Fri, 16 Oct 2009 04:38:40 +0000 (04:38 +0000)]
fix per r57729#c4267
Chad Horohoe [Fri, 16 Oct 2009 04:06:30 +0000 (04:06 +0000)]
bug 9982. Encapsulate wgCanonicalNamespaceNames. Patch by Scott Colcord, with updates
Chad Horohoe [Fri, 16 Oct 2009 03:53:59 +0000 (03:53 +0000)]
Remove some unused globals